Paranaguá is a historic coastal city in Paraná, Brazil, known for its rich colonial architecture and vibrant port activities. Nestled among lush Atlantic rainforest and offering access to the beautiful Ilha do Mel, the city is a gateway to natural beauty and cultural heritage. Its cobblestone streets and colorful buildings reflect a blend of Portuguese, indigenous, and African influences. As one of Brazil’s oldest cities, Paranaguá offers visitors a glimpse into the past with well-preserved landmarks, such as the Nossa Senhora do Rosário Church and the Mercado Municipal, alongside modern amenities and a bustling maritime economy.

Best Time to Visit Paranaguá

The best time to visit Paranaguá is from April to October, during the dry season. This period offers pleasant temperatures and lower humidity, perfect for exploring the city’s historical sites and enjoying outdoor activities on Ilha do Mel without the risk of heavy rainfall.
